Kibana解决使用Custom无法正确选择时间的问题
来源:互联网 发布:灰指甲怎么根治 知乎 编辑:程序博客网 时间:2024/06/06 05:06
Kibana的时间选择框太恶心,Custom选项不能用,to date只能选择UTC时间。查了好久源码,终于找到问题所在啦!
由于Kibana在时间选择空间上的max date设置为UTC时间,而该死的UTC时间比中国时间少了8个小时,这导致,使用Custom进行选择的时候永远都选不到当前的时间。而且在使用All Time、7day这样的time frame的时候,也会出现to date为UTC时间,虽然最后结果是正确的,但是,这样很诡异,有木有=。=
修改方法:
Kibana目录下,static/lib/js/文件夹中,有一个叫做ajax.js的文件,里面有一句话“maxDatetime: utc_date_obj(new Date()),”,就是这句话,设置了控件最大能选择的时间是当前时间-8个小时(默认使用UTC时间,默默的被剪掉8小时T_T)。
把这句话改为“maxDatetime: utc_date_obj(new Date(Date.parse(new Date())+tOffset)),”就可以啦~!
- Kibana解决使用Custom无法正确选择时间的问题
- 解决kibana 4 关于响应时间的问题
- 解决使用Maven项目,无法正确编译的问题
- 解决ubuntu下无法正确显示GBK编码的问题
- 解决ubuntu下无法正确显示GBK编码的问题
- 解决Win8/8.1无法正确识别USB3.0的问题
- 一次页面引用文件无法正确加载问题的解决
- 解决unity中Animation Event无法正确保存的问题
- 解决无法正确预览布局文件的问题
- linux 正确安装opencv解决无法读取视频的问题
- 选择正确DOCTYPE解决CSS不起作用问题
- VMware player使用桥接模式 - 解决无法选择桥接网卡的问题
- CMonthCalCtrl得到正确的时间选择
- MonthCalCtrl得到正确的时间选择
- 解决SVN安装语言包后无法选择中文的问题
- 解决eclipse的new server里tomcat 无法选择问题
- 解决eclipse的new server里tomcat 无法选择问题
- 解决SVN安装语言包后无法选择中文的问题
- Reactor模式,或者叫反应器模式
- SQL学习笔记5
- JS数组方法汇总 array数组元素的添加和删除
- 第四周项目2
- flexigrid 的使用【添加错误处理功能】
- Kibana解决使用Custom无法正确选择时间的问题
- IOS学习笔记18—UIImageView .
- 关于Android UI组件LinearLayout属性layout_weight与layout_width/height的问题
- 编写js扩展方法实现判断一个数组中是否包含某个元素
- 开始学数据结构和算法了,,坚持把代码出来
- 一个合格的程序员应该读过的书
- c语言文件操作函数
- java如何实现多态性,基于itable, vtable源码分析
- iOS-raywenderlich翻译-UIPopoverController 使用教程